CLOSE BUSINESS OF THE YEAR 1912
Commissioners Met Thursday and Closed Up the Business for > the Year 1912. The county commissioners met Thursday for the purpose of closing up the business of the year and to let the contract for supplies for the various offices. The contract for stationery and supplies in Classes 1, 2 and 3 was let to the Burt-Haywood Co., of Lafayette. Class 4 was awarded to Healey & Clark, of Rensselaer. Devere Yeoman filed a new bond as surveyor-elect in the sum of SI,OOO, Signed by Andrew K. Yeoman, Stephen Kohley and E. J. Randle. Through an oversight the amount was not filed in the previous bond, so that a new one was necessary. W. L Hoover filed a bond for $5,««0 as sheriff-elect. It was signed by Wm. M. Hoover and Frank Hoover. Frank Owen Wood was admitted to the Home for Feeble Minded.
